PASabreFan Posted March 8, 2006 Report Share Posted March 8, 2006 March 8, 1989 In his Sabres' debut, Clint Malarchuk makes 32 saves to shut out the Rangers in New York, 2-0. March 8, 1995 In Montreal, Dominik Hasek stops Mark Recchi on a penalty shot. The Sabres and Habs tie. March 8, 1997 In Montreal, Dominik Hasek stops Vincent Damphousse on a penalty shot. The Sabres and Habs tie. March 8, 2002 Marty Biron pitches a 26-save shutout for the second time in 24 hours and Chris Gratton scores the winner as the Sabres blank the Canadiens at HSBC Arena, 3-0. Mr. Microphone and mates had shut out the Islanders the night before on Long Island, 5-0. They are the ninth and 10th shutouts of Biron's career.
